 * I have noticed that a space is inserted after the footnote reference number when
   it is displayed in a post. This poses a problem if the footnote is at the end
   of a sentence but is before a period.
 * Example: `This is a sentence[ref]some text[/ref].` (this is how I have formatted
   a footnote that comes just before a period). But the generated reference number
   displays as `[1] .` (notice the space before the period).
 * Is there a way to eliminate the space after the reference numbers?

 * Well, perhaps this isn’t an issue after all. According to [The Chicago Manual of Style](http://www.chicagomanualofstyle.org/qanda/data/faq/topics/Punctuation/faq0020.html):
 * > “A note number should generally be placed at the end of a sentence or at the
   > end of a clause. The number normally follows a quotation (whether it is run
   > into the text or set as an extract). Relative to other punctuation, the number
   > follows any punctuation mark except for the dash, which it precedes.”
 * That being the case, the remaining space may not be a problem since there is 
   normally a space after a period at the end of sentence. I’ll just have to ensure
   that my clients properly place the footnote after the periods.
